在ASP.net中编写方法以从OAuth API获取令牌,可以按照以下步骤进行:
- 导入所需的命名空间:
- 导入所需的命名空间:
- 创建一个异步方法来获取令牌:
- 创建一个异步方法来获取令牌:
- 在需要使用令牌的地方调用该方法:
- 在需要使用令牌的地方调用该方法:
这样,你就可以在ASP.net中编写方法以从OAuth API获取令牌了。
对于OAuth API的概念,它是一种开放标准,用于授权第三方应用程序访问用户资源,而无需提供用户名和密码。它通过令牌的方式进行身份验证和授权,提供了更安全和可靠的用户身份验证机制。
OAuth API的优势包括:
- 安全性:OAuth API使用令牌进行身份验证,避免了直接传输用户名和密码的风险。
- 用户友好性:用户可以选择授权给第三方应用程序访问特定资源的权限,提供了更好的用户控制权。
- 可扩展性:OAuth API支持多种授权流程和不同的应用场景,适用于各种应用程序和平台。
在ASP.net中使用OAuth API可以实现各种场景,例如:
- 第三方登录:用户可以使用其它平台的账号登录你的ASP.net应用程序,如使用微信、QQ等账号登录。
- API访问授权:你的ASP.net应用程序可以通过OAuth API获取到令牌,然后使用该令牌访问受保护的API资源。
腾讯云提供了一系列与云计算相关的产品,其中包括身份认证和授权服务,可以用于实现OAuth API。你可以参考腾讯云的身份认证和授权服务了解更多信息。